So here's my story, long: Dad upgraded to SP2 all in one
chunk online. Everything seemed OK. Shut it down, The next
morning it wont boot up, keeps saying there is problems
with my MSGina.dll file. I call up tech suport and they
say I need to run the setup disks and then the install
disc. CAnt find my install Disc anywhere! So I go get xp
Pro, Now it wont install, keeps saying it has a problem
with a .sif file-value 0 on the line section
[sourcedisksfiles] with key "sp2.cab". How do I fix this?

What exactly does it say about the MSGina.dll file? Paraphrasing an
error message can be worse than useless when seeking support. What is
needed is the *verbatim* text as in more than a few instances it is
the presence or the absence of a single word in the error message text
that is the essential clue needed to identify the culprit.

Here, for example is one possible solution to your problem:

"Logon User Interface DLL Msgina.dll failed to load" error message
after you install the MS04-003 security update
Microsoft Knowledge Base Article - 836683
http://support.microsoft.com?kbid=836683


If that is not relevant to your situation then please post a response
back here and include the actual error message text.
